Comprehending Registered Agents in Washington
A designated agent serves a crucial position in the business arena of the state. This individual or organization is appointed to accept formal documents, such as service of process, tax-related communications, and regulatory communication on behalf of a firm. By having a designated agent, companies ensure that they stay aware of any legal actions or legitimate correspondence, which is crucial for upholding good standing and continuity in business activities.
In Washington, the law stipulates that every commercial entity, including corporations and limited liability companies, choose a registered agent. This individual must have a tangible street address in the state and be present during normal business hours to accept vital documents. This condition helps establish a trustworthy point of interaction between the company and state authorities, enhancing openness and responsibility in business operations.

Fees and Offerings of WA Registered Agents
When selecting a registered agent in Washington, comprehending the costs linked with their services is essential for small business owners. On average, Washington registered agents charge between fifty to 300 dollars annually, depending on the degree of service provided. Basic services often consist of acting as a point of contact for legal documents, whereas advanced packages might include extra offerings such as compliance monitoring, mail forwarding, and annual report filing assistance.
The variety of services provided by Washington registered agents can vary significantly. Some agents specialize solely on receiving and forwarding legal documents, while others offer comprehensive compliance services. Compliance Guidelines for Washington Registered Agents
In Washington, agents of record must meet specific compliance requirements to ensure they can effectively serve businesses. To act as a designated agent, an organization must have a actual address in Washington where legal documents and official correspondence can be delivered. This location cannot be a P.O. how to get a registered agent must be a physical street address, which is deemed the agent's official office. This requirement ensures that there is a reliable place for the receipt of service of process.
Furthermore, registered agents must be available during typical business hours to accept legal documents. This is essential because the prompt receipt of documents can affect a company's ability to respond to legal actions. Additionally, if a business fails to maintain a designated agent, it may face penalties, including the dissolution of its business entity, which may disrupt operations and lead to further legal complications.
To remain in compliance, agents of record in Washington are also responsible for informing the state of any changes in their address or status. If an agent wishes to withdraw, they must file a resignation form with the Secretary of State. It is crucial for companies to choose a trustworthy registered agent who can ensure adherence to these compliance requirements, as overlooking them can have major consequences for their legal standing in the state.

Changing Your Registered Agent in Washington
Updating your registered agent in Washington is a straightforward process that makes sure your business stays compliant with state regulations. A registered agent is essential for handling legal documents and official communications on for your LLC or corporation. If you realize that your current agent is not meeting your needs or if you wish to switch providers, you can initiate the change by submitting the appropriate documentation with the Secretary of State for Washington.
To successfully change your registered agent, you will need to finish and submit the “Change of Registered Agent” form. You can get this form via the internet or request a physical if you would like. Make sure to provide the necessary details, such as the name and address of the incoming registered agent, and any required charges. It is crucial to make sure that your new agent is authorized to do business in Washington and meets all state criteria for agents of record.
After submitting your change application, check that the update has been completed by the Secretary of State for Washington's office. This may take a few days, so be prepared. Once approved, your new agent of record will assume responsibilities for receiving legal documents and ensuring compliance with the state of Washington's annual reporting requirements.
